THE Archdiocese of Milan has opened an office of socialpastoral action to carry out the counsels of Mater et Magistra. the recent social encyclical of Pope John XXIII.
The office plans to co-operate Is ilk all organizations working for social justice.
Cardinal Nfontini. Archbishop of Milan, said the office will work with "all associations and endeavours of whatsoever denomination or origin, which in the boundaries of the archdiocese seek with declared Christian intent the welfare or workers. leaders and employers."
Milan is Italy's chief industrial city.
Cardinal NIonlini, also urged Catholics of his archdiocese to commemorate the Church's ecumenical councils bj. building 21 new churches. 20 for the councils of the past and one for the coming Second Vatican Council.
The Cardinal noted: "Milan has always marked with its own original and extremely expressive acts the history of Christian culture. "It should also pay tribute to the history of the councils ... by constructing new churches needed for the city's pastoral life, so that by the end of 1963, 21 new churches may be dedicated to saints or characteristic acts of the 21 ecumenical councils of the Catholic Church."
Cardinal Montini emphasized that more than 21 new churches are needed to keep pace with the development of the city's postwar growth.
